Biography of The Sopranos

The Sopranos is a crime drama that follows the life of mob boss Tony Soprano as he navigates the challenges of managing his family and his criminal organization. The show is renowned for its psychological depth, particularly in exploring Tony's struggles with mental health and his relationships with family and associates. The ensemble cast, including both lead and supporting actors, played a crucial role in bringing this story to life, making it a benchmark for future television series.

Main Cast of The Sopranos

The main cast of The Sopranos consists of several talented actors who each contributed to the show's success. Below is a table summarizing the key cast members along with their character names and roles:

ActorCharacterDescription
James GandolfiniTony SopranoThe complex mob boss struggling with personal and professional issues.
Edie FalcoCarmela SopranoTony's devoted yet conflicted wife, navigating their tumultuous marriage.
Michael ImperioliChristopher MoltisantiTony's protégé, dealing with addiction and aspirations in the mafia.
Lorraine BraccoDr. Jennifer MelfiTony's psychiatrist, who helps him navigate his psychological struggles.

James Gandolfini as Tony Soprano

James Gandolfini's portrayal of Tony Soprano revolutionized the depiction of anti-heroes on television. His ability to capture the character's vulnerability, anger, and charm made him a standout performer, earning him multiple awards, including three Primetime Emmy Awards for Outstanding Lead Actor in a Drama Series.

Edie Falco as Carmela Soprano

Edie Falco brought depth and complexity to the role of Carmela Soprano, Tony's wife. Her performance showcased the struggles of a woman caught between loyalty to her husband and her own moral dilemmas. Falco's work earned her several accolades, including Emmy Awards and Golden Globes.

Michael Imperioli as Christopher Moltisanti

Michael Imperioli's character, Christopher Moltisanti, represented the younger generation in the mafia, grappling with issues of ambition, addiction, and loyalty. His multifaceted performance added layers to the show, earning him an Emmy Award for Outstanding Supporting Actor in a Drama Series.

Lorraine Bracco as Dr. Melfi

Lorraine Bracco's role as Dr. Jennifer Melfi was pivotal in exploring Tony's psyche. As his psychiatrist, she provided a unique perspective on his struggles, making her character an essential part of the narrative. Bracco's performance was critically acclaimed, earning her several award nominations.

Supporting Cast of The Sopranos

In addition to the main cast, The Sopranos featured a rich ensemble of supporting characters that contributed significantly to the show's depth. Notable supporting cast members included:

  • Dominic Chianese as Corrado "Junior" Soprano
  • Steven Van Zandt as Silvio Dante
  • Tony Sirico as Paulie "Walnuts" Gualtieri
  • Jamie-Lynn Sigler as Meadow Soprano
  • Robert Iler as Anthony "A.J." Soprano Jr.

Each of these characters played a critical role in shaping the narrative and adding complexity to the interactions within Tony's world. Their performances were instrumental in making The Sopranos a groundbreaking series.

The Impact of The Sopranos on Television

The Sopranos set a new standard for television drama, influencing countless shows that followed. Its exploration of complex characters, moral ambiguity, and psychological depth paved the way for a new era of storytelling on television. The show's success demonstrated that audiences were ready for more sophisticated narratives that tackled real-life issues.

Moreover, The Sopranos broke traditional storytelling norms, allowing for character development that was both gradual and profound. The show’s blend of dark humor, violence, and family dynamics resonated with viewers, making it a cultural touchstone.
